Description
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to bypass authentication process.
The vulnerability exists due to an error in when processing authentication requests. A remote attacker can bypass authentication process and gain unauthorized access to the application.
The vulnerability was dubbed ProxyToken.
Mitigation
Install updates from vendor's website.
